
The 20 Best WordPress Plugins to Use in 2021
WordPress plugins extend the functionality of a website without requiring every feature to be developed from scratch. The right plugins can improve SEO, security, forms, analytics, speed and user experience.

The best WordPress plugins to use
A good plugin must solve a real need, remain updated, be compatible with your theme and avoid slowing the website unnecessarily. Installing too many plugins without a strategy can create technical problems.

1. Yoast SEO
Yoast SEO helps manage titles, meta descriptions, XML sitemaps, readability and basic on-page optimization. It is useful for teams that publish content regularly.

2. MonsterInsights
MonsterInsights simplifies the connection between WordPress and Google Analytics. It helps website owners follow traffic and understand user behavior more easily.

3. WPForms
WPForms allows you to create contact forms, quote forms and simple lead generation forms. Forms are essential because they turn visitors into contacts.

Security plugins
Security plugins help protect login pages, monitor suspicious activity and reduce common vulnerabilities. They are not a replacement for good maintenance, but they add useful protection.

Performance plugins
Caching, image optimization and database cleaning plugins can improve loading speed. Performance matters for SEO, user experience and conversion.

E-commerce plugins
WooCommerce and related extensions help build online stores. The choice of plugins must be careful because payment, delivery, stock and customer experience are sensitive areas.

How to choose WordPress plugins
Check update frequency, user reviews, compatibility and documentation. Prefer fewer high-quality plugins over many overlapping tools.
